    Claude Agent SDK

    Claude

    Empower autonomous AI agents to tackle real-world challenges.
    The Claude Agent SDK is an all-encompassing toolkit designed for developers interested in crafting autonomous AI agents that harness Claude's functionalities, enabling them to perform practical tasks that go beyond simple text generation by interacting directly with various files, systems, and tools. This SDK is built upon the same foundational infrastructure as Claude Code, which includes an agent loop, context management, and integrated tool execution, and it is available for developers using both Python and TypeScript. By utilizing this toolkit, developers can design agents that have the ability to read and write files, execute shell commands, perform web searches, amend code, and automate complex workflows without needing to construct these capabilities from scratch. Furthermore, the SDK guarantees that agents retain a continuous context and state during their interactions, thus allowing them to operate seamlessly, navigate intricate multi-step challenges, take suitable actions, validate their outcomes, and adjust their strategies until their tasks are accomplished.     21st

    21st.dev

    Empower your applications with seamless AI agent integration.
    21st is a developer-focused platform designed to simplify the creation and deployment of AI agents within modern software applications. The platform provides an SDK that allows developers to define agents using simple code while integrating tools, prompts, and AI models. It supports multiple development environments and frameworks including Next.js, React, TypeScript, Python, Node.js, and other common programming stacks. Developers can configure agents to run on advanced runtimes such as Claude Code or Codex, enabling tool usage, file access, and intelligent task execution. Once the agent configuration is defined, deployment can be completed using a single command that automatically sets up infrastructure. The platform manages backend systems such as sandboxed execution environments, authentication, rate limits, and streaming responses. It also includes a drop-in chat interface component that developers can embed directly into their applications to enable user interaction with agents. Real-time token streaming allows users to see responses generated progressively, creating a more interactive experience. The platform provides built-in observability tools that allow developers to monitor conversations, replay sessions, and trace agent actions. These features make debugging and optimization much easier during development and production. 21st also includes usage controls such as per-user spending limits, quotas, and metering to help manage AI costs.     Strands Agents

    Strands Agents

    Empower your AI agents with seamless control and flexibility.
    Strands Agents SDK is a powerful open-source framework built to help developers design, control, and deploy AI agents with greater flexibility and reliability. Supporting both Python and TypeScript, it enables developers to build agents using familiar programming paradigms without relying on complex orchestration systems. The SDK allows tools to be defined as simple functions, which the AI model can call dynamically during execution. This approach removes the need for rigid pipelines and gives developers more control over how agents behave. It is compatible with any AI model or cloud provider, making it highly adaptable for different environments and enterprise needs. A key feature of Strands is its steering system, which allows developers to intercept and guide agent actions before and after execution. This improves accuracy, safety, and compliance by ensuring that agents follow defined rules. The SDK also supports multi-agent architectures, enabling collaboration between agents to solve complex tasks. Built-in memory management helps maintain context across extended conversations, reducing the need for manual token handling. Observability tools provide insights into agent performance, including tool usage, model calls, and execution flow. Additionally, the evaluation SDK allows developers to test and refine agent behavior before deploying to production.     Tabstack

    Mozilla

    Empower your AI with seamless web data extraction!
    Tabstack is a managed web API platform that lets developers extract, research, generate, and automate across the live web without building their own scraping stack. The platform is designed for teams that want to pass in a URL, schema, question, or task and get back structured data, clean Markdown, cited answers, or completed browser actions. Its /extract/json endpoint returns schema-matched JSON from web pages, making it useful for product details, job listings, pricing pages, marketplaces, directories, and other structured web data. Its /extract/markdown endpoint converts pages into clean Markdown that can be used for RAG pipelines, documentation ingestion, product page indexing, and knowledge base workflows. The /generate/json capability supports reasoned structured output from user instructions, not just direct field extraction. The /research endpoint runs a live-web research agent that selects sources, reads pages, synthesizes findings, and returns cited answers with claim-level support. The /automate endpoint lets users describe a browser task in natural language and have Tabstack navigate, click, fill forms, and complete flows on websites the user does not control. Tabstack supports interactive mode for human input, JavaScript-heavy pages, streaming results over SSE, TypeScript and Python SDKs, MCP connectivity, and CLI access. Its Pilo browser engine is designed to reduce token usage compared with screenshot-heavy approaches while still enabling browser-based automation. Common use cases include competitive intelligence dashboards, lead enrichment pipelines, research agents, booking and checkout agents, back-office workflow automation, and knowledge base ingestion.     OpenAI Agents SDK

    OpenAI

    Effortlessly create powerful AI agents with streamlined simplicity.
    The OpenAI Agents SDK empowers developers to build agent-based AI applications in an efficient and intuitive way, reducing unnecessary complications. This SDK is an advanced iteration of our previous project, Swarm, aimed at agent experimentation. It includes a streamlined collection of essential components: agents, which are sophisticated language models equipped with specific directives and tools; handoffs, which support the distribution of tasks among agents; and guardrails, which ensure that inputs from agents are accurately validated. By utilizing Python in conjunction with these components, developers can create complex interactions between tools and agents, enabling the creation of effective applications without facing a steep learning curve. Additionally, the SDK features built-in tracing capabilities that allow users to visualize, debug, and evaluate their agent workflows, as well as to fine-tune models to meet their unique requirements.     AgentSea

    AgentSea

    Empower your AI creations with seamless, open-source collaboration.
    AgentSea is a groundbreaking open-source platform that simplifies the creation, deployment, and sharing of AI agents. It offers a comprehensive array of libraries and tools for building AI applications while following the UNIX principle of specialization. These tools can operate on their own or be integrated into a larger agent application, ensuring they work seamlessly with well-known frameworks like LlamaIndex and LangChain. Some of its standout features include SurfKit, which serves as a Kubernetes-style orchestrator for agents; DeviceBay, a system designed for the integration of pluggable devices such as file systems and desktops; ToolFuse, which allows users to encapsulate scripts, third-party applications, and APIs as Tool implementations; AgentD, a daemon that enables bots to access a Linux desktop environment; and AgentDesk, which supports virtual machines powered by AgentD. In addition, Taskara helps with task management, while ThreadMem is built to create persistent threads that can handle multiple roles effectively. MLLM simplifies interactions with various LLMs and multimodal LLMs. Moreover, AgentSea includes experimental agents like SurfPizza and SurfSlicer, which effectively leverage multimodal strategies to interact with graphical user interfaces.     Superpowers

    Superpowers

    Transform AI coding agents into disciplined engineering partners.
    Superpowers is an open-source skills framework and software development methodology created to make AI coding agents behave more like disciplined engineering collaborators. The project provides a structured set of workflows that activate automatically when an agent is asked to build, modify, debug, or review software. Rather than allowing the agent to rush into implementation, Superpowers encourages it to ask clarifying questions, refine the idea, and produce a clear design before code is written. After the user approves the design, the framework guides the agent to create a detailed implementation plan that breaks the work into small, verifiable engineering tasks. Each task can include file paths, code guidance, testing instructions, and clear completion criteria. Superpowers strongly promotes test-driven development through a red-green-refactor process that requires failing tests before implementation. It also supports subagent-driven development, where fresh agents work through tasks and review outputs for both specification compliance and code quality. The framework includes additional skills for systematic debugging, verification before completion, parallel agent workflows, code review, git worktrees, and branch finishing. Superpowers works across several coding agent harnesses, including Claude Code, Codex CLI, Codex App, Factory Droid, Gemini CLI, OpenCode, Cursor, and GitHub Copilot CLI. Its philosophy prioritizes evidence over claims, simplicity over unnecessary complexity, and systematic workflows over ad-hoc guessing.     TypeScript

    TypeScript

    Transform your coding experience with enhanced error detection.
    TypeScript enhances JavaScript with improved syntax, creating a smoother integration with development environments, which helps in identifying errors early on within the editor. The TypeScript code is compiled into JavaScript, making it compatible with a wide range of platforms such as web browsers, Node.js, Deno, and mobile apps. Its understanding of JavaScript allows TypeScript to utilize type inference, providing robust tooling while reducing the need for extensive additional code. According to the 2020 State of JS survey, 78% of participants indicated they use TypeScript, and an impressive 93% of those surveyed plan to keep using it. The most common errors developers face are often type errors, where an unexpected type of value is encountered within a specific context. These mistakes can arise from simple errors such as typos, misinterpretations of a library’s API, incorrect assumptions about how code executes at runtime, or various other oversights.     Bun

    Bun

    Experience lightning-fast JavaScript development with seamless efficiency.
    Bun serves as an all-in-one toolkit for JavaScript, TypeScript, and JSX, acting as a standalone executable that combines a high-performance runtime, package manager, test runner, and bundler, presenting an efficient alternative to Node.js while boasting extensive compatibility and remarkably reduced startup times and memory usage. Created using Zig and leveraging Apple's JavaScriptCore, Bun executes JavaScript and TypeScript files, scripts, and packages with a performance that outshines traditional tools, and it inherently supports zero-configuration setups for TypeScript, JSX, and React applications. The integrated package manager significantly accelerates dependency installations, achieving speeds up to 30 times faster than npm, with additional features such as workspaces, global caching, migration support, and dependency auditing. Moreover, Bun's test runner, which is compatible with Jest, not only includes built-in coverage but also supports concurrent execution of tests, while its bundler can seamlessly manage TypeScript, JSX, CSS, and more without the need for configuration, enabling the straightforward creation of single-file executables.
